WebMay 13, 2024 · Nigerian dwarf goats’ nutritional requirements. Goats need energy and protein to build, rebuild, and produce enough milk, including vitamins, minerals, and amino acids, to strengthen their body cells and organs against illness. Carbohydrates can be obtained from cereals (barley, wheat, corn, and oats) and processed energy-given goat feed. Standard-size goats have a butterfat around 3% to 3.5%, except Nubians, which average 4.5%, and Nigerians, which average 6.5%. We were on milk test … florists in port alberni bc
